About the Company

We envision a world where we continuously, sustainably, and affordably improve human life with synthetic biology. Our proprietary set of enzymes and our manufacturing approach enables the production of thousands of amino acids that were previously too difficult and expensive to make. These "noncanonical" amino acids that we make are already catalyzing the creation of revolutionary and innovative products that are good for people and the planet.

Our technology outperforms traditional manufacturing approaches by 10–100x across the board. We already sell products to Big 10 Pharmaceutical companies, and our product family includes the key components of multi-billion dollar blockbuster drugs such as Ozempic and Mounjaro.

About the role

We're looking for a marketer who can do more than just run campaigns: they can connect our products to the scientists who need them. As our first dedicated marketing hire, you'll build the foundation for how Aralez Bio engages with current and future customers. You'll report to the VP of Sales and work closely with our sales and scientific teams to generate demand, qualify leads, and support buying decisions through smart, useful content.

This is a hands-on role for someone who thrives in a cross-functional environment, balances creativity with data, and isn't afraid to dive into technical subject matter. You'll own all our customer-facing marketing channels and campaigns, and your work will directly shape how customers find us, understand us, and choose to work with us.

Success in this role means delivering a measurable increase in qualified leads, improving the efficiency of the sales process, and helping us sharpen our product messaging and positioning through real customer insight.

On-site in Berkeley, CA is preferred, but hybrid or remote arrangements are possible.

What You'll Do

Generate Demand: Bring in the right potential customers through targeted content and campaigns.

  • Own customer-facing marketing channels (e.g. website, email, social media, webinar, conference) and track their performance.
  • Create campaigns and content that attract life science/biotech audiences and positions Aralez as a thought leader.

Qualify Leads: Deliver high-quality, sales-ready leads with the context sales needs to take action.

  • Own lead capture workflows (e.g., forms, landing pages, automation) and create multi-touch nurture campaigns to move leads toward sales readiness.
  • Evaluate and prioritize leads based on MQL criteria, ensuring sales receives qualified prospects with relevant context.
  • Monitor lead performance through the funnel and adjust targeting and nurture strategy to improve conversion to SQL.

Sales Enablement: Accelerate deals and expand opportunities with sharp, well-informed materials and positioning.

  • Conduct research (e.g., market intel, sales calls, usage data) to understand customer needs, objections, and market trends.
  • Apply insights to create tailored sales content for a scientific audience, guide product and market direction, and support launches with clear messaging and training materials.

What You'll Bring

  • Demonstrated ability to independently execute marketing campaigns, create content, and support sales without heavy oversight—this is the first full-time marketing role at Aralez Bio.
  • Experience marketing to technical buyers, ideally within pharma, biotech, or related scientific industries.
  • Sees marketing as a way to help technical buyers find and choose the right solution by translating complex ideas into clear, high-value messaging focused on customer needs.
  • This is a hands-on role with wide scope and inherent ambiguity. Must be able to juggle multiple priorities, ship quickly, make progress with limited direction, and adjust based on feedback.
  • Strong communicator who values sharp, straightforward writing. Prefers done and effective over perfect and polished.
  • BS in life sciences, chemistry, or a related technical field preferred, due to the scientific nature of our platform and the need to communicate clearly in a fast-growing, technically complex market.
  • Familiarity with CRM (Salesforce preferred) and marketing automation tools.
